**Ticket PICKOPT-registry: Expired creds on PickWise optimizer**

Hey, welcome aboard! Quick one for you: the PickWise pick-list optimizer stopped pulling slotting data from the Shelfstream service last night because the old key expired. Nobody rotated it before Marnie left, classic. You'll need to update the worker config in the pickwise-batch repo and redeploy to the Halverton warehouse cluster. Takes about ten minutes total. The replacement credential for Shelfstream is below.

app token of bahaf-tajeg = zpat23_SjjsllwiLmXbtS65veZaV47

Subject: Large-Deal Discount Policy — Orientation for Incoming Director

Team, as Mira Valsk joins us next week, I want to summarize our discount framework for deals above the Tier-3 threshold. Discounts beyond 18% on the Corvane platform require dual sign-off from Revenue Operations and Legal, and anything exceeding 25% must be escalated to this group with a margin analysis attached. Please review the attached exceptions log before Monday's session. For context, the following note outlines where we intend to take pricing strategy next quarter.

management briefing: Project Ulavan slips by two quarters because of the staffing delay.

## Authentication

Heads up: the nightly reindex job (`reindex_nightly.py`) talks to the Lanternfish search cluster, and that cluster won't accept anonymous writes anymore — we locked it down last sprint. The job now authenticates as the `reindex-runner` service identity against Corvid Gateway, and the token is injected via the `LF_INDEX_TOKEN` env var in the scheduler config. Nothing clever going on, just a bearer header on every batch request. For review purposes, the staging credential currently in use is listed below.

service key, kadug-kadup: kto15_rN23XLAYImmZgrJ

## Formula sandbox tuning

User-supplied formulas in Gridmoor execute inside a restricted interpreter with hard ceilings on time, memory, and call depth. Reviewers should confirm any change to these ceilings is justified in the PR description, since raising them widens the abuse surface. Defaults were chosen from production traces. The current limits are as follows.

limits module of tafog-fawip:
WEIGHTS = {
    "julix": 57,
    "lamys": 992,
    "kasvan": 209,
    "quenok": 750,
    "alddor": 259,
    "oliath": 1009,
    "wenix": 815,
}